Serving 456 students in grades Kindergarten-6, William R. Anton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 20% (which is lower than the California state average of 33%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 26%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.

School Overview

William R. Anton Elementary School's student population of 456 students has declined by 31% over five school years.
The teacher population of 23 teachers has declined by 23% over five school years.
